词源
From Latin vīgēsimus (“twentieth”), variant of Latin vīcēsimus (“twentieth”), from Latin vīgintī (“twenty”), (from *vīcēnssos, from Proto-Indo-European *wi(h₁)ḱm̥ttós, with the -imus ending of decimus (“tenth”)) + -al (suffix forming an adjective). Compare Latin vīgintī (“twenty”), from Proto-Indo-European *h₁wih₁ḱm̥ti, from *dwi(h₁)dḱm̥ti(h₁), *dwi(h₁)dḱm̥ti (“two tens; two decades”).
